Student-Made OWU gives Ohio Wesleyan students the tools, platform, and community to turn ideas into businesses.
Whether you already have a side hustle, create products, offer a service, or simply have an idea, Student-Made gives you the opportunity to develop it, promote it, and connect with customers and other student-creators.
Student-Made is a national program that helps college students create, market, and sell their products and services.

You don't have to already have a business to participate.
A recent Student-Made OWU feasibility study found interest from students representing 22 different majors. Of the students interested in selling products or services, 63.6% have an idea they want to develop, while 36.4% already have something they want to sell.
Student ideas range from art and handmade products to training programs, technology, and other services.
Your idea could be next.
Student-Made OWU is led by Ohio Wesleyan students and supported by The Woltemade Center for Economics, Business and Entrepreneurship.
